Lead Construction ProjectsManage day-to-day construction site operations from mobilization through project completion. Lead and coordinate subcontractors, suppliers, and field personnel. Develop and maintain project schedules and drive production to meet milestones. Ensure all work is completed in accordance with project drawings, specifications, and quality expectations. Monitor and enforce site safety procedures and company safety standards. Conduct jobsite meetings and communicate progress to project stakeholders. Coordinate inspections, testing, and permitting requirements. Identify and proactively resolve construction challenges and schedule conflicts. Drive productivity while maintaining quality workmanship. Review construction documents and collaborate with project management teams on RFIs, submittals, and change orders. Maintain accurate project documentation, daily reports, and field records.
